ソースを参照

Merge pull request #1188 from sanand0/master

Display .stretch images in overview mode. Fix #1187
Hakim El Hattab 5 年 前
コミット
65938f388b
1 ファイル変更5 行追加0 行削除
  1. 5 0
      js/reveal.js

+ 5 - 0
js/reveal.js

@@ -1765,10 +1765,15 @@
 			// Change the .stretch element height to 0 in order find the height of all
 			// the other elements
 			element.style.height = '0px';
+			// In Overview mode, the parent (.slide) height is set of 700px.
+			// Restore it temporarily to its natural height.
+			element.parentNode.style.height = 'auto';
 			newHeight = height - element.parentNode.offsetHeight;
 
 			// Restore the old height, just in case
 			element.style.height = oldHeight + 'px';
+			// Clear the parent (.slide) height. .removeProperty works in IE9+
+			element.parentNode.style.removeProperty('height');
 
 			return newHeight;
 		}